Web3 de ene. de 2024 · under the rent stabilization system. However, if the tenant has reason to believe that this rent exceeds a “fair market rent”, the tenant may file a “Fair Market Rent Appeal” with DHCR. The owner is required to give the tenant notice, on DHCR Form RR-1, of the right to file such an appeal. The notice must be served by certified mail.

WebThe new law extends protections to all renters across New York State. HSTPA makes changes to eviction procedures, caps security deposits/fees, and allows municipalities across the state to opt-in to rent stabilization. Whether you are a regulated or unregulated tenant, or a manufactured home community resident, you now have more rights. WebNew York State has also banned advertisement for rentals in “Class A” dwellings that are in violation of the Multiple Dwellings Law’s restriction on short-term rentals. Penalties on those who are found by the New York City Office of Special Enforcement to be violating this law begin at $1,000 for the first violation.

Web3 de abr. de 2024 · Maximum Deposits. The Housing Stability and Tenant Protection Act of 2024 states that landlords in New York are only permitted to request a security deposit equal to a month's rent. Keep in mind that the maximum security deposit amount applies exclusively to residential properties that are not rent-stabilized.
